start ->start_armboot ->main_loop
實際應用中問題:為什麼從nandflash讀出的MAC(寫到物理phy上)與上層網口地址不同(上層網口採用env的mac)?
從nandflash讀出mac並寫入phy後,才初始化網路裝置即eth_initialize(),
其讀取env中的ethaddr儲存mac到gd中,即上層介面應用中。
start ->start_armboot ->main_loop
實際應用中問題:為什麼從nandflash讀出的MAC(寫到物理phy上)與上層網口地址不同(上層網口採用env的mac)?
從nandflash讀出mac並寫入phy後,才初始化網路裝置即eth_initialize(),
其讀取env中的ethaddr儲存mac到gd中,即上層介面應用中。